Transaction 51a529ef11d6290d60e3b9223a155ce3fdf227f4909735e00147f8c323ec601b
1 Input
2 Outputs
- 51a529ef11d6290d60e3b9223a155ce3fdf227f4909735e00147f8c323ec601b:0
- 51a529ef11d6290d60e3b9223a155ce3fdf227f4909735e00147f8c323ec601b:1
value 98015
address 14sgThXTkXqdSBUVJLfpXBDyLofvskKtEo
value 524042
address 1EqYQjZnry2ED9tUDRGr3mrQgoi8JhhpD3